Old Vine Shiraz

2007 Clare Valley Shiraz

The Fire Block Old Vine Shiraz from the Clare Valley showcases an exquisite example of this renowned varietal. Deep ruby in color, this vintage presents an enticing bouquet of dark fruit, spice, and subtle hints of earthiness. The body is full and expressive, offering a mouthcoating experience that highlights the richness of the wine. Acidity is bright, lending a refreshing lift that beautifully contrasts with the intense fruit character. Tannins are well-structured and firm, enhancing the wine's longevity while ensuring a smooth and satisfying finish. On the palate, the fruit intensity is prominent, showcasing layers of blackcurrant and plum, complemented by nuances of black pepper and chocolate. This shiraz is dry, making it an excellent companion for hearty dishes or simply enjoyed on its own. The old vines contribute to the complexity and depth, making this a striking representation of the Clare Valley's unique terroir.

Region:


Clare Valley

Clare Valley is one of Australia's most highly prized wine regions. Riesling here is bright and beautiful, famed for its limey zing and food friendliness. The vineyards are isolated, being naturally protected from nearby maritime influences by the Mount Lofty Range. The area's complex limestone soils and extreme climate are responsible for many of its thrilling varietals. With such a long growing season, Cabernet Sauvignon and Merlot also perform well in the Clare Valley, producing red wines of impressive definition and structure.
